Dan Plutchak has spent more than 20 years as a community news journalist.
In 2009, he was promoted to associate editor with Bliss Communications and is responsible for WalworthCountyToday.com, the Gazette's news website covering the Lake Geneva area in Walworth County, Wis.
The local news site combines content produced for the print editions of the Gazette and CSI Media's weekly newspapers, along with edited aggregate of local online news and original content produced specifically for the site.
Prior to that, he was associate editor for the Bliss Communication's newly-acquired CSI community newspaper group based in Delavan , Wis.
Until the acquisition in 2008 of CSI Media, Plutchak was editor of The Week, a twice-weekly print and daily online news publication covering Walworth County in southeastern Wisconsin.
Plutchak has gained a national reputation for drawing readers with innovative content, design and delivery platforms. The Week has won numerous awards from The National Newspaper Association, The Wisconsin Newspaper Association and the Wisconsin News Photographers' Association. It won a second-place award as best weekend newspaper in the country
in 2007.
